Output 307527ab2646c8ed79dd9990f9028cfea83f26868aea4aa4ed45517803f917de:3

value
41426698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eec41e2237d8182a1e8ac78acd5577798c8943da OP_EQUAL
address
MVfdzan5LS7N3Aru6SnhiC3SmKUJexVS7L
transaction
307527ab2646c8ed79dd9990f9028cfea83f26868aea4aa4ed45517803f917de
spent
true